Oak Canyon to Grasslands Path

The Oak Canyon to Grasslands Path is a extremely popular San Diego-area path for runners, hikers, and birdwatchers. You’ll discover a stream and waterfalls alongside the trail, together with wildflowers and native timber. It’s an important spot to get out and luxuriate in San Diego nature!

Deal with: 1 Father Junipero Serra Path, San Diego, CA 92119

Mileage: 3.7 miles

Loop Path

Terrain: The path is packed dust that could be arduous for wheelchairs and strollers to navigate.

Problem: It is a reasonably difficult path

Open year-round: Sure

Miles from downtown San Diego: 12.4 miles from downtown San Diego

Pet-friendly? Sure, canines are allowed on this path, however have to be leashed. Make sure to convey baggage and decide up after your pet!

Child-friendly? It is a kid-friendly path. There may be some elevation acquire, so chances are you’ll need to take it gradual with smaller youngsters, or convey a backpack to hold them. Youngsters can search for wildflowers, benefit from the stream, and look ahead to native wildlife alongside the path.

Cowles Mountain from Barker Means

The Cowles Mountain from Barker Means Path is a considerably difficult path, with over 800 ft of elevation acquire. You’ll get nice metropolis views, together with views of the encompassing mountains. It’s a preferred path for hikers, runners, and mountain bikers, so that you’ll most likely meet others alongside your hike.

Deal with: 1 Father Junipero Serra Path, San Diego, CA 92119

Mileage: 2.3 miles

In and Out Path

Terrain: This path is packed dust. It’s a tough path to navigate with a wheelchair or stroller.

Problem: That is thought-about a reasonably difficult path.

Open year-round? Sure

Miles from downtown San Diego: 12.4 miles from downtown San Diego

Pet pleasant? This path does enable canines on a leash. Make sure to convey baggage and decide up after your pet!

Child-friendly? It is a kid-friendly path, though it is going to be difficult for smaller youngsters. You could need to take it gradual, or have a pack to hold them in the event that they get drained.

Sundown Cliffs Park Path

The Sundown Cliffs Park Path gives you superb ocean views, and is a well-liked spot for different hikers and bikers. It’s additionally a enjoyable spot to convey a canine on a pleasant, sunny day. That is a straightforward path, with out a number of elevation acquire, so it must be manageable for teenagers in addition to adults.

Deal with: Ladera St, San Diego, CA 92107

Mileage: 1 mile

In and Out Path

Terrain: Sundown Cliffs is usually a packed dust path, with some boardwalk as nicely. It might be difficult to navigate with a stroller or wheelchair.

Problem: That is thought-about a straightforward path.

Open year-round? Sure

Miles from downtown San Diego: 9.2 miles from downtown San Diego

Pet pleasant? Sure, canines are allowed on this path, and so they may even be off-leash in some areas.

Child-friendly? It is a kid-friendly path. Youngsters will love exploring the seaside and the close by cliffs.

Grasslands Loop Path

The Grasslands Loop Path is well-liked with birdwatchers, hikers, and runners. It’s a considerably difficult route, with some elevation acquire. It follows a stream and has some tree cowl, so that you shouldn’t get too scorching climbing right here, however convey loads of water and solar safety nonetheless.

Deal with: 1 Father Junipero Serra Path, San Diego, CA 92119

Mileage: 4.3 miles

Loop Path

Terrain: It is a packed dust path. It might be arduous for a wheelchair or stroller to navigate this path.

Problem: That is thought-about a reasonably difficult path.

Open year-round? Sure

Miles from downtown San Diego: 12.4 miles from downtown San Diego

Pet pleasant? Sure, canines are allowed on this path. They have to be on a leash, and don’t neglect to select up after your pet!

Child-friendly? It is a kid-friendly path. Some smaller youngsters might have hassle with the size of the path, however you possibly can at all times minimize it quick or carry them in a climbing backpack.

San Dieguito River through Coast to Crest Path

The San Dieguito River through Coast to Crest Path follows the river, passing a historic adobe farmstead, an interpretive website, and loads of overlooks and scenic viewpoints. It’s a preferred path, and chances are you’ll discover different hikers, bikers, or runners on the path.

Deal with: 18448 W Bernardo Dr, San Diego, CA 92127

Mileage: 2.8 miles

In and Out Path

Terrain: It is a packed dust path that will be arduous for wheelchairs or strollers to handle on a hike.

Problem: That is thought-about a straightforward path.

Open year-round? Sure

Miles from downtown San Diego: 26.5 miles from downtown San Diego

Pet pleasant? Sure, canines are allowed on this path, however have to be leashed. Make sure to convey baggage and decide up after your pet!

Child-friendly? It is a kid-friendly path. Youngsters can search for native wildflowers and wildlife alongside the path as they stroll, and luxuriate in views of the river.
